The 15 most banned books in U.S. schools
The recent report by PEN America highlights a troubling trend in U.S. schools, where books like 'A Clockwork Orange,' 'Last Night at the Telegraph Club,' and 'Wicked' are among the most banned for the 2024-2025 school year. This censorship raises concerns about the freedom of expression and the diverse perspectives that students are exposed to, making it crucial for educators and parents to advocate for literary access.

Stephen King named most banned author in US schools
NegativeU.S News
Stephen King has been named the most banned author in U.S. schools for the 2024-2025 school year, according to a report by PEN America. With 87 of his books, including classics like 'The Stand' and 'It,' being banned a staggering 206 times, this highlights a troubling trend in book censorship. This matters because it raises concerns about freedom of expression and the impact of censorship on education and literature.
